
The city's biggest rising star will return to the Liverpool stage this month for the 2010 Summer Pops festival.
Kirkby-born Stephen Langstaff is rapidly becoming one of the UK's most prolific singer songwriters
Fresh from touring with Liverpool legends The Lightning Seeds, and as part of the O2 'Academy Live' tour, Stephen headlines the Summer Pops stage on Friday 30th July at the Liverpool Guild of Student's Stanley Theatre.
Stephen said: "I'm really excited to be part of The Summer Pops Festival this year.
"2010 has been a great year already for me and to headline in my hometown is special."
With a recent top 5 spell for his infectious anthem ‘Saw the Angels’ in the Amazon download chart as well as upcoming festival dates, his confidence is understandably riding high.
And with a number of UK tours, festival appearances and record breaking gigs behind him, Stephen is attracting more and more support for his already loyal following and a reputation that has gone from strength to strength.
He added: "I'm really lucky to have loyal supporters. And for anyone who has never seen me live before, this gig is perfect."
